Chinese Tile Theme

Mahjong Ways uses familiar tile styling rather than fruit or card symbols. The theme gives the reels a distinct look while keeping the paytable easy to read inside the game.

Cascading Action

Matched tiles disappear and new ones drop into their spaces, creating extra movement inside a single paid round. The rhythm is quick, so clear animations matter on every screen.

Multiplier Build

The multiplier can become the centre of attention once cascades begin to chain. We keep the title frame uncluttered so you can watch that build without side panels pulling focus.

After a winning tile pattern lands, those tiles clear and new symbols drop into place. A single paid round can then continue through extra cascades, with the game frame showing each step.
